Chamaecyparis lawsoniana 'Stewartii', also known as the False Cypress, Port-Orford-Cedar, Lawson Cedar, or Lawson Cypress, is a stunning evergreen tree with unique features. One of its distinct characteristics is its leaf type, which is described as scale-like. However, what truly sets this variety apart is its striking leaf coloration.

In addition to its stunning coloration, this false cypress offers numerous other benefits. It is an evergreen tree, meaning it retains its foliage throughout the year, providing year-round beauty to any landscape. It also has a dense and bushy growth habit, making it an excellent choice for privacy screens or as a windbreak.

While the Chamaecyparis lawsoniana 'Stewartii' is a captivating tree, it does require specific growing conditions to thrive. It prefers full sun or partial shade and well-drained soil. This variety is moderately drought-tolerant once established but benefits from regular watering during hot and dry periods.

When it comes to landscaping, this false cypress is incredibly versatile. Its unique leaf coloration makes it an ideal choice for adding contrast and vibrancy to any garden or landscape design. Whether used as a specimen tree, in a mixed border, or as part of a hedge, the Chamaecyparis lawsoniana 'Stewartii' is sure to make a statement.
